The latest edition of Robin Black‘s 5 Rounds on the Fight Network is his greatest, eva. In it he debuts The Sapp-Alvarez Scale, which reveals the intangibles in the sport.

On the horizontal scale is risk taking or risk aversion. On the vertical scale is Willingness And Ability to Embrace Suffering. At one extreme in the sport sits Bob Sapp, and at the other, Eddie Alvarez.

Using the scale, Black looks at Francis Carmont, Brock Lesnar, Jon Jones, and GSP, and discusses the sweet spot.

Black is a former glam rock star, who brings the passion of fighting and the passion of rock n roll to his breakdowns, and to his work as an MMA color commentator and media figure, both on the Canadian MMA scene and internationally.
